Food and beverage companies are facing increasingly complex food safety and quality program requirements, including those associated with Global Food Safety Initiative (GFSI) programs. If your company is struggling to keep up with changing regulations, you could be an ideal candidate for a GFSI management solution. Here, we take a look at some of the time, money, and labor-saving benefits of GFSI software to help you determine if it’s the right choice for your organization.
- Automated GFSI Records Management: Manual data entry is time- and labor-intensive. Paper, clipboards, and filing cabinets also takes up added space and money. With software, you can eliminate manual processes and instead automate your GFSI records management.
- Real-time GFSI Data Monitoring: To ensure you’re complying with the requirements set forth by GFSI, you must have a measurable program in place to mitigate risks and deliver safe food products. Yet, if you’re not keeping track of your program data in real-time, there’s no way to know for sure that your program is effective. Automated solutions capture data instantly to help managers verify program requirements are being met daily, saving time and hassle in the process.
- Track Program Performance: Software helps you identify where inefficiencies in your FSQA programs lie. In addition to making sure requirements are being met daily, you can also analyze program data over a specific time frame to identify top challenges. This can help you eliminate redundancies and make more informed decisions to reduce material loss, which will ultimately help you limit resource expenditure.
- Instant Access to Data for GFSI Audits: If you need to track down critical information using a paper-based system, it could take a significant amount of time. Busy managers can’t afford to dedicate lengthy spans of time to document retrieval. Today’s solutions provide instant access to all of the records and program data you need.
- Auto-Schedule Tasks & Reminders: How much time is spent in your organization sending out reminders and scheduling GFSI required tasks? An automated solution can take the hassle out of scheduling tasks and sending reminders so your managers can dedicate their time and attention to more strategic outcomes.
